Airdrie boss Ian Murray is without doubt one of the bookies' favourites to take over from John McGlynn at Raith Rovers.
McGlynn and assistant Paul Smith stepped down from their roles on the Championship membership yesterday, and are anticipated to maneuver to League One Falkirk.
Diamonds boss Murray has steered them to the Championship play-offs following a formidable second positioned season in League One, however they path Montrose 1-0 within the semi-final first leg.
Murray is certainly one of a number of names linked to Stark's Park, with Kevin Thomson favorite, after steering Kelty Hearts to the League Two title, adopted by former Dundee boss James McPake.
Clyde boss Danny Lennon - a former Rovers participant - and Murray are subsequent on the checklist, because the Kirkcaldy membership attempt to discover a substitute.
Raith Rovers have invited purposes to be despatched to chief govt Karen McCartney forward of their Could 13 time limit.
